    Understanding Uterine Fibroids

    Fibroids are noncancerous growths that develop in the uterus. They are common and often occur during the reproductive years. Many women with fibroids experience symptoms like heavy bleeding, pelvic pressure, and a feeling of fullness.

    What Are The Symptoms of Fibroids?

    Symptoms can vary depending on the size and location of the fibroids. Common signs include heavy menstrual bleeding, pelvic pain, and frequent urination. Some women may also notice abdominal swelling or a feeling of pressure.

    Understanding How Fibroids Are Diagnosed

    Doctors usually diagnose fibroids through physical exams and imaging tests. An ultrasound is most common, providing detailed images of the uterus.

    Tests Used to Detect Fibroids

    • Ultrasound
    • MRI scans
    • Pelvic exam

    These tools help determine the size, number, and location of fibroids, guiding treatment options.

    Potential Complications That Affect Weight

    Some complications from fibroids can influence body weight indirectly, such as anemia or infections. These conditions may decrease appetite or cause fatigue, influencing weight.

    Severe Bleeding and Anemia

    Heavy bleeding caused by fibroids can lead to anemia, which might contribute to weight loss due to fatigue and reduced eating. However, this is not a direct effect of fibroids themselves.

    Infections and Inflammation

    Rarely, infected fibroids or related complications can cause systemic illness, potentially leading to weight loss. These situations require prompt medical attention.

    Management and Treatment Options

    Treatment depends on the size, symptoms, and impact of fibroids on a woman’s health. Options may range from watchful waiting to surgical procedures.

    Conservative Approaches

    Sometimes, no immediate treatment is necessary if fibroids are small and asymptomatic. Regular monitoring can be sufficient.

    Medical Treatments

    Medications like hormonal therapy can help shrink fibroids or reduce symptoms. These do not typically influence weight directly but can improve overall health.

    Surgical Interventions

    Procedures such as myomectomy or hysterectomy are used to remove fibroids when symptoms are severe. Surgery might cause temporary changes in weight due to recovery but does not cause long-term weight loss.
